Thuraya FT2225
Thuraya M2M: Real-time, secure, two-way communications
The FT2225 satellite M2M terminal enables connectivity for remote assets and sensors for monitoring, control and security of critical applications in the oil & gas, utilities, mining, banking and government sectors. By utilizing our robust IP-based, highly secure, two-way communications Thuraya M2M network, you can extend the deployment of M2M and IoT applications in real-time beyond the traditional coverage areas of cellular networks. The FT2225 can also be used to provide redundancy and backup M2M communications for mission-critical applications via satellite in situations where highly resilient communications is required in times of crisis or natural disasters.
- Real IP (Not store and forward)
- High level cyber-security (AES256K)
- Low Latency (sub 800ms)
- Broadcast & Multicast capability
- Rugged devices with OTA SW updates
- SLA backed 99.9% Network availability

WEIGHT | 900 g |
---|---|
DIMENSIONS | 178 × 130 × 42 mm |
NARROWBAND IP | TX 1626.5 to 1675.0 MHz R X 1518.0 to 1559.0 MHz Typical latency <2 sec 100 bytes |
TRANSMISSION SECURITY | Link encryption AES-256 |
GNSS | GPS + GLONASS (L1 frequency) |
POWER | 10 to 32 VDC, via multi-pin connector, short circuit and surge protection |
WI-FI | IEEE 802.11 B/G, 2.4 GHz |
EXTERNAL INTERFACES THAT CAN BE SUPPORTED | Ethernet, Serial, CAN Bus, Modbus and USB 2.0 Via multi-pin connector |
SIZE | (L x W x H) 178 x 130 x 42 mm |
WEIGHT | <900g |
SOLAR RADIATION | 1120 W/m2 p per IEC-60068-2-5 |
RELATIVE HUMIDITY | Up to 100% condensing at 45° C, per IEC 60068-2-30 |
INGRESS PROTECTION | IP66 dust and spray proof in all directions |
WIND SPEEDS | Up to 200 km/hr |
AIR PRESSURE TRANSPORT | 500 m AMSL |
TRANSPORT | -40° to +85° C |
STORAGE | -40° to +85° C |
OPERATIONAL | IEC 60068-2-64, 50 m/s2, 11 ms |
SURVIVAL | Transportation shock per IEC 60068-2-29, A = 180 m/s2, t = 6 mS |
CE | Per R&TTE Directive 1999/5/EC, Low Voltage Directive 2006/95/EC |
FCC | Title 47 Section 15, Title 47 Section 25 |
RCM | AS/NZS CISPR 22:2009 Safety IEC/EN/AS/NZS 60950-1, IEC/EN/AS/NZS 60950-22 |
ROHS | Per European Union Council Directive 2011/65/EU |
REACH | Per European Union Council Directive 1907/2006/EC |
WEEE | Per European Union Council Directive 2012/19/EU |
